It seems with the latest Intrepid update of KNetworkManager 0.7 I can no
longer select a network that shows up in the list (One that has been
configured). It looks like everything else is working (the networks
show up and they have signal strength), but when I click on a network to
associate nothing happens. The menu closes like I clicked on a non-menu
item. When I check the logs there are none to be seen. Nothing
happened at all. I even tried to delete and recreate the connection,
but that also had no effect. When I remove and reinsert my USB wireless
adapter it shows up in the logs just fine (NetworkManager daemon crashes
when I remove my USB wireless though). I have tried to reboot and
repeat an attempt to connect, but no success. I have tried with my
built-in Realtek 8185 and the USB external TrendNet TEW-424UB. Both
worked before the last update, neither work now.
